| Specification | Arizer ArGo | Linx Eden |
|---|---|---|
| Price (USD) | $129 | $100 |
| Device Type | Portable | — |
| Heating Type | Conduction | Convection |
| Heat Up Time | ~60 seconds | — |
| Temperature Range | 50°C-220°C | — |
| Battery Type | Swappable 18650 | — |
| Battery Capacity | — | 2500mAh |
| Battery Life | ~90 minutes | — |
| Charging | Micro USB | Micro USB |
| Charge Time | — | 3 - 4 hours |
| Pass-Through Charging | Yes | — |
| Dimensions | 93x52x24mm | 24 x 130mm |
| Weight | — | 116 grams |
| Power Adjustment | Digital Control | — |
| Brand | Arizer | Linx Vapor |
The biggest practical difference is heating approach: Arizer ArGo runs conduction while Linx Eden runs convection. That changes flavor delivery, vapor density, and how the device responds to slow versus fast draws.
Linx Eden is the cheaper option at $100 compared with $129 for the Arizer ArGo, about $29 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.
Arizer ArGo uses conduction heating, while the Linx Eden uses convection.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.
Yes, only the Arizer ArGo supports pass-through charging. The Linx Eden has to finish charging before you can use it.
